TMMG is seeking an experienced Production Support / Engineering Change / Shipboard Configuration / Production Readiness Specialist to provide onsite support to shipbuilding and ship repair programs at Fincantieri Marinette Marine (FMM). Success Looks Like Success in this position is not measured simply by the number of engineering changes or work orders reviewed. The objective is to keep production moving. The individual should consistently identify problems before they affect major milestones, provide Manufacturing with accurate and executable technical information, drive unresolved engineering and production issues to closure, maintain an accurate picture of actual shipboard configuration, and give FMM and TMMG leadership confidence that reported production status reflects what is actually happening aboard the vessel. The position ultimately helps reduce production delays, prevent unnecessary rework, improve engineering-change execution, protect critical schedule milestones, and improve the flow of information between Engineering and the shipyard workforce. Requirements Production Readiness and Workability Review production orders, work orders, parent items, engineering changes, drawings, material status, and schedule requirements to determine whether planned work is ready for Manufacturing execution. Research work that cannot be executed and identify the specific condition preventing completion. Determine the actions necessary to make work executable and identify the Engineering, Planning, Material, Manufacturing, Scheduling, Configuration Management, or other organization responsible for resolution. Investigate the following production constraints: material shortages or unavailable components, incomplete predecessor work, unreleased or incorrectly structured work orders, drawing or design discrepancies, bill of material or configuration discrepancies, incorrectly incorporated engineering changes, production sequencing conflicts, administrative or scheduling issues, and differences between documented configuration and actual shipboard conditions. Work directly with responsible organizations to resolve identified constraints and return work to an executable status. Support production priorities based on vessel milestones, schedule requirements, critical-path activities, and Manufacturing needs. Engineering Change and Configuration Support Review Engineering Change Notices (ECNs), drawings, work packages, production orders, and supporting technical information to determine applicability and completion status. Perform shipboard validation of engineering changes and configuration requirements. Determine whether engineering changes have been fully incorporated into the vessel and identify incomplete, incorrectly implemented, or unverified work. Research production orders, material, drawings, parent items, and associated documentation supporting open engineering changes. Determine the path necessary to move incomplete engineering changes from unresolved status through production completion and final verification. Maintain accurate change-status and configuration information for assigned vessels or projects. Validate hull or vessel applicability of engineering changes and identify discrepancies between engineering records and actual ship configuration. Support equipment foundation, structural, electrical, piping, outfitting, and other configuration-status validation as assigned. Shipboard Production Support Conduct routine ship checks and deck-plate inspections to verify actual conditions aboard vessels under construction or repair. Compare installed shipboard conditions against drawings, engineering changes, work packages, job orders, and configuration records. Identify conditions that prevent or complicate installation and production work. Provide timely technical clarification to supervisors, planners, engineers, and trades when discrepancies are identified. Mark up drawings, blueprints, sketches, or other technical information as necessary to clearly communicate required work. Assist trades in understanding engineering-change scope and translating technical requirements into executable production work. Verify equipment location, routing, access, foundations, interfaces, and other physical conditions affecting installation. Conduct follow-up ship checks to confirm that corrective actions and engineering changes have been satisfactorily completed. Engineering-to-Production Integration Serve as a working interface between Engineering and Manufacturing to ensure technical requirements can be successfully executed on the vessel. Identify situations where approved engineering does not reflect actual shipboard conditions or creates production challenges. Coordinate with Engineering to obtain clarification, revised information, or technical direction when required. Help ensure drawings, ECNs, work packages, material requirements, and production instructions provide the trades with sufficient information to perform the work correctly. Identify recurring engineering or production problems and recommend improvements that reduce rework, delays, and wasted labor. Support Engineering with shipboard validation and status assessments when accurate configuration information is required. Schedule and Milestone Support Review production activities in relation to the Integrated Master Schedule (IMS), forecast start dates, vessel milestones, and production priorities. Help identify engineering changes, material issues, production orders, or configuration discrepancies that could affect critical milestones. Support launch, test, delivery, and other major milestone readiness reviews by validating completion of critical work. Assist leadership in identifying remaining critical work and the resources, actions, and responsible organizations required to complete it. Support development and maintenance of production-readiness and schedule-analysis information across assigned vessels or projects. Elevate emerging production constraints before they become schedule-critical issues. Data Analysis, Tracking, and Reporting Maintain accurate production-support, engineering-change, configuration, and readiness trackers. Update ECN validation and change-status information based on current engineering releases and verified shipboard conditions. Develop and maintain status reports, action lists, dashboards, report cards, and other management tools showing open and completed engineering changes, workable versus unworkable production activities, outstanding departmental actions production constraints and root causes, critical work remaining by vessel, module, system, or milestone, and progress toward resolution. Provide leadership with accurate information that reflects actual production and shipboard conditions rather than relying solely on reported completion status. Identify trends and recurring root causes and recommend corrective actions or process improvements. Participate in production, engineering, planning, and program coordination meetings as required. Knowledge, Skills, and Abilities The Successful Candidate Should Be Able To Understand how engineering requirements translate into actual shipyard production work. Recognize when a drawing, engineering change, work order, material requirement, or shipboard condition does not align with the planned work. Trace a production problem through engineering, material, planning, scheduling, and manufacturing information to identify its root cause. Distinguish between work that is technically complete, administratively complete, and physically complete aboard the vessel. Communicate effectively with engineers, planners, schedulers, production supervisors, trades, and senior management. Work independently and take ownership of issues through final resolution rather than simply identifying and reporting problems. Organize large quantities of technical and production information and identify the issues requiring immediate attention. Balance technical accuracy with the practical needs of shipyard production. Develop practical solutions in a fast-moving construction environment. Recognize emerging schedule and production risks and elevate them before they affect major milestones.
